Property Details for 77 Camilleri St, Dolphin Heads

77 Camilleri St, Dolphin Heads is a 6 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 10 parking spaces and was built in 2004. The property has a land size of 52620m2 and floor size of 405m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in August 2010.

About Dolphin Heads 4740

The size of Dolphin Heads is approximately 0.9 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 0.8% of the total area. The population of Dolphin Heads in 2016 was 388 people. By 2021 the population was 413 showing a population growth of 6.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dolphin Heads is 50-59 years. Households in Dolphin Heads are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dolphin Heads work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 59.20% of the homes in Dolphin Heads were owner-occupied compared with 56.90% in 2016.

Dolphin Heads has 367 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dolphin Heads have seen a 59.69%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 193.61%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Dolphin Heads is $879,797 while the median value for Units is $235,557.
  • Houses have a median rent of $498 while Units have a median rent of $550.
There are currently 9 properties list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Dolphin heads on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 30 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Dolphin heads.
